
Vue项目开发指南:heimamm基础操作流程
下载需积分: 9 | 360KB |
更新于2025-01-11
| 200 浏览量 | 举报
收藏
该项目基于npm(Node.js包管理器)进行依赖管理,提供了一系列的命令行接口(CLI)来简化开发流程。项目中包含了多种常见的开发步骤和配置选项,如开发环境下的实时编译、热重装、生产环境下的编译与最小化以及代码风格检查等。"
知识点详细说明:
1. 项目设置与依赖管理
- npm install:此命令用于安装项目所需的所有依赖。在开发Vue项目时,这些依赖包括Vue核心库、路由器、状态管理库等。
- 自定义配置:项目允许开发者查看和修改配置文件,以满足特定的项目需求。这通常涉及调整webpack配置、babel设置、ESLint规则等。
2. 开发工具与流程
- 编译和热重装:在开发过程中,使用热重装(Hot Reloading)功能可以在不刷新整个页面的情况下,将新代码应用到正在运行的应用上,极大地提高了开发效率。
- npm run serve:该命令用于启动一个开发服务器,它在本地提供了一个开发环境,并且具备编译和热重装功能。通常,开发服务器会监听源代码文件的变化,并在每次保存更改时自动重新编译和重载应用。
3. 生产构建
- npm run build:此命令用于构建生产环境所需的代码。它会执行一系列的优化操作,如代码分割、压缩、移除调试信息等,最终生成可以部署到生产服务器的静态文件。
4. 代码质量控制
- 整理和修复文件:在开发过程中,代码风格和格式的统一是很重要的。npm run lint命令会运行一个名为ESLint的工具,它负责检测源代码中可能存在的错误和不符合预设规则的代码风格问题。
- 请参阅:这通常意味着,为了更好地理解和使用这些命令和配置,开发者需要查看项目的文档或者官方指南,了解如何自定义和扩展项目配置以适应具体需求。
5. Vue框架
- Vue.js是一种轻量级的前端JavaScript框架,它专注于构建用户界面。Vue的设计哲学是逐步学习和集成,鼓励开发者从一个小的功能开始,逐步构建复杂的单页应用(SPA)。
6. 命令行接口(CLI)
- Vue CLI是一个基于Vue.js进行快速开发的完整系统,提供了一系列工具化的功能来简化Vue项目的创建和开发流程。CLI工具通常包含初始化项目、添加插件、运行本地服务器、构建生产版本等命令。
7. 文件名称列表说明
- 压缩包子文件的文件名称列表为heimamm-master,这表明该项目可能是一个版本控制系统的仓库名称(如Git),并且使用了master作为默认的主分支名称。在这种情况下,开发者可以检出这个仓库,开始使用npm进行安装和开发。
综上所述,heimamm项目为使用Vue.js框架的前端开发人员提供了一个完整的开发环境。通过npm管理依赖,利用Vue CLI来简化项目的构建和维护,以及使用npm提供的脚本来执行开发和生产环境下的各种任务。开发者可以根据项目的具体需求,进行配置修改和代码风格的统一。
相关推荐


















kudrei
- 粉丝: 51
最新资源
- nowmachinetime.github.io项目网站测试分析
- 量化分析利器:Python定量数据处理包
- 掌握GitHub页面开发:goit-markup-hw-05教程
- JavaScript项目38-结束版发布
- FIA_Lab4_test:Python编程实验报告
- JavaScript实现的在线数学测验应用
- 太空旅行社的未来发展与HTML技术应用
- Java开发环境激活活动库教程
- caleb-oldham1的第二个网站项目分析
- Java网络支持实践与Web技术
- 编码村:CSS与前端开发的实践社区
- React+Express+MySQL实现Todos项目教程
- 构建个性化Github个人资料页面指南
- 联想IH81M-MS7825 BIOS更新与售后支持指南
- win64平台的openssl动态库下载指南
- GraphLite:提升C++图形计算的轻量级平台
- Python个人资料库:深入理解Repositorio结构
- 自动化导出虚拟网络工具dummynet源码教程
- JetBrains Python开发工具深度解析
- PHP框架SF5终止使用教程
- spoofer-props:Magisk模块,绕过CTS实现设备属性伪装
- 深入浅出:ActiveX控件开发实例解析
- Python压缩包子工具的深入分析
- C语言Lab7实验报告解析